2-Day Family-Friendly Itinerary: Mount Abu & Ambaji

Day 1: Mount Abu

On Saturday, July 29, 2023, explore the scenic beauty of Mount Abu, a popular hill station in Rajasthan.

Morning:

Start your day by visiting the magnificent Dilwara Jain Temples. These intricately carved marble temples are a testament to exquisite craftsmanship.

  • Dilwara Jain Temples: Free entry, 2-3 hours
Afternoon:

Enjoy a peaceful picnic at Nakki Lake, the heart of Mount Abu. Take a boat ride or simply relax by the lakeside amidst stunning natural surroundings.

  • Nakki Lake: Boat ride - INR 50 per person, 1-2 hours
Evening:

Witness a mesmerizing sunset from the Sunset Point. This popular viewpoint offers breathtaking panoramic views of the Aravalli Range.

  • Sunset Point: Free entry, 1-2 hours

Day 2: Ambaji

On Sunday, July 30, 2023, make your way to Ambaji, a renowned pilgrimage town in Gujarat.

Morning:

Visit the sacred Ambaji Temple, dedicated to the goddess Amba. Experience the serene ambiance and seek blessings amidst the religious fervor.

  • Ambaji Temple: Free entry, 2-3 hours
Afternoon:

Explore the stunning surroundings of Gabbar Hill, known for its picturesque landscapes and significant religious significance.

  • Gabbar Hill: Free entry, 1-2 hours
Evening:

Take a leisurely stroll through the bustling local market of Ambaji. Indulge in some shopping, sample local delicacies, and soak in the vibrant atmosphere.

  • Ambaji Market: Shopping and food expenses vary, 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Secrets

Mount Abu and Ambaji offer plenty of family-friendly attractions and activities. While exploring Mount Abu, consider visiting the Brahma Kumaris Spiritual University and Museum, which provides valuable insights into spirituality and meditation. Additionally, don't miss out on the Toad Rock, a fascinating rock formation resembling a toad, located near Nakki Lake.

Ambaji has an amusement park called Kamakshi Mandir Vidyapith that offers fun rides and entertainment for children. It makes for an enjoyable family outing. Another hidden gem is the Kumbhariya Jain Temples, situated around 3 km from Ambaji. These ancient temples are renowned for their beautiful carvings and tranquility.
